    "The Benefits of Hybrid and Remote Work for Modern Staffing Firms: Maintaining Control While Offering Flexibility"

    In this engaging, interactive, and entertaining presentation, you as a staffing firm leader will dramatically improve your ability to offer the flexibility needed to recruit and retain talented staffing professionals in your company while maintaining the accountability and control you need as a leader to accomplish your business objectives. Many staffing firm leaders still rely on traditional office-centric collaboration and management styles in managing hybrid and remote teams: that’s what they learned to do before the pandemic, and they keep applying what they learned in the new post-pandemic world. Yet research conclusively demonstrates that, instead of incrementally improving on the old-school office-centric approach, the best outcomes in managing hybrid teams comes from adopting a flexible hybrid-first work model. Doing so results in much higher retention, productivity, engagement, collaboration, cost savings, and risk mitigation. A hybrid-first model involves best practices adapted specifically to hybrid work contexts, which allow leaders to maintain control and accountability. Such best practices include remote coworking, weekly performance evaluations, addressing proximity bias, and a culture of "Excellence from Anywhere." This training offers case studies and best practices that you need to most effectively manage hybrid and remote staff to help you modernize your staffing firm and adapt to our increasingly-disrupted future of work.
